Claim Settlement Ratio – the concept

Claim Settlement Ratio (CSR) is a numerical figure that measures the claims that a life insurance company has settled successfully against the total claims that were made on it. The ratio is measured in a percentage and the higher the percentage the more favourable the insurer is when it comes to claim settlement. 

Claim Settlement Ratio – (number of claims settled / total number of claims raised) * 100

For example, if an insurer settles 99 claims out of 100, its CSR would be 99%.

Latest Claim Settlement Ratio of life insurers

The Insurance Regulatory and Development Authority of India (IRDAI) calculates and publishes the CSR of life insurance companies in its annual report. This report captures the CSR of each financial year. For the financial year 2020-21, the IRDAI published its reports in December 2021. The report stated the following figures –

  • In the financial year 2020-21, an aggregate claim of 11.01 lakhs was raised on life insurance companies for individual life insurance policies. Against this, 10.84 lakh claims were settled valuing INR 26,422 crores. 
  • 9527 claims were repudiated valuing INR 865 crores
  • 3032 claims were rejected valuing INR 60 crores
  • 3055 claims were pending to be cleared by the end of the financial year valuing INR 623 crores

The financial year 2020-21 was good for policyholders as the claim rejections and repudiations were reduced. Here are some numbers – 

  • The overall CSR of the life insurance industry was recorded at 98.39% in FY 2020-21. This is an increase compared to 96.76% CSR which was recorded in FY 2019-20
  • The claim repudiation or rejection ratio reduced to 1.14% in FY 2020-21 compared to 1.28% in FY 2019-20

Now let’s look at the CSR of life insurance companies for the financial year 2020-21 –

Name of the insurance company 

Claim Settlement Ratio

Claims Repudiated 

Aditya Birla Sun Life Insurance Company Limited 

98.04%

1.79%

Aegon Life Insurance Company Limited

99.25%

0.75%

Ageas Federal Life Insurance Company Limited

95.07%

2.11%

Aviva Life Insurance Company Limited

98.01%

1.99%

Bajaj Allianz Life Insurance Company Limited

98.48%

1.49%

Bharti AXA Life Insurance Company Limited

99.05%

0.95%

Canara HSBC OBC Life Insurance Company Limited

97.1%

1.58%

Edelweiss Tokio Life Insurance Company Limited

97.01%

2.59%

Exide Life Insurance Company Limited

98.54%

0.22%

Future Generali Life Insurance Company Limited

94.86%

4.49%

HDFC Life Insurance Company Limited

98.01%

0.49%

ICICI Prudential Life Insurance Company Limited

97.9%

1.95%

IndiaFirst Life Insurance Company Limited

96.81%

2.68%

Kotak Mahindra Life Insurance Company Limited

98.5%

1.14%

Max Life Insurance Company Limited

99.35%

0.64%

PNB MetLife Life Insurance Company Limited

98.17%

1.83%

Pramerica Life Insurance Company Limited

98.61%

1.24%

Reliance Nippon Life Insurance Company Limited

98.49%

1.47%

Sahara India Life Insurance Company Limited

97.18%

1.81%

SBI Life Insurance Company Limited

93.09%

3.8%

Shriram Life Insurance Company Limited

95.12%

3.72%

Star Union Dai-ichi Life Insurance Company Limited

95.96%

3.55%

TATA AIA Life Insurance Company Limited

98.02%

1.94%

Life Insurance Corporation of India 

98.62%

0.69%

Max Life and Aegon Life led the race with the highest claim settlement. LIC also posted a good figure of 98.62%. 

Things to know about CSR

The CSR helps you pick the right insurer who would provide you with a smooth claim settlement experience. However, here are a few things to know about CSR –

  • CSR does not measure the claim amount settled by the insurer. It only measures the number of claims settled.
  • If a claim is raised towards the end of the financial year, it might remain outstanding when the CSR is calculated. This affects the CSR
  • If you make a fraudulent claim, it would be rejected, even if the insurance company has a high CSR.
